MAX78000
AI Development PlatformThe MAX78000 is a ai development platform from Maxim Integrated. View the full MAX78000 datasheet below including electrical characteristics, absolute maximum ratings.
Manufacturer
Maxim Integrated
Category
AI Development Platform
Package
81 CTBGA
Overview
Part: MAX78000EXG+ — Maxim Integrated Type: Artificial Intelligence Microcontroller Description: An ultra-low-power AI microcontroller featuring an Arm Cortex-M4 with FPU CPU up to 100MHz, a 32-bit RISC-V coprocessor up to 60MHz, and a hardware-based convolutional neural network (CNN) accelerator with 442KB weight storage and 512KB data memory, designed for edge AI applications.
Operating Conditions:
- SIMO Supply Voltage Range: 2.0V to 3.6V
- Operating temperature: -40°C to +105°C
- Arm Cortex-M4 Processor: up to 100MHz
- RISC-V Coprocessor: up to 60MHz
Absolute Maximum Ratings:
- Max V COREA, V COREB: +1.21V
- Max V DDIO, V DDIOH, V REGI: +3.6V
- Max V DDA: +1.89V
- Max V DDIO Combined Pins (sink): 100mA
- Max V DDIOH Combined Pins (sink): 100mA
- Max Output Current (sink) by any GPIO Pin: 25mA
- Max Output Current (source) by any GPIO Pin: -25mA
- Max Storage Temperature: -65°C to +150°C
Key Specs:
- Flash Memory: 512KB
- SRAM: up to 128KB
- CNN Weight Capacity: 442k 8-Bit (supports 1, 2, 4, 8-bit weights)
- CNN Data Memory: 512KB
- GPIO Pins: Up to 52
- Active Mode Current (CM4 only): 22.2μA/MHz (at 3.0V from cache)
- Input Supply Voltage, Battery (V REGI): 2.45V (rising) to 3.6V (falling)
- Input Supply Voltage, GPIO (V DDIO): 1.71V to 1.89V
Features:
- Dual Core Ultra-Low-Power Microcontroller (Arm Cortex-M4 and RISC-V)
- Hardware-based Convolutional Neural Network (CNN) Accelerator
- Integrated Single-Inductor Multiple-Output (SIMO) Switch-Mode Power Supply (SMPS)
- Dynamic Voltage Scaling
- 12-Bit Parallel Camera Interface (PCIF)
- I2S Master/Slave for Digital Audio Interface
- AES 128/192/256 Hardware Acceleration Engine
- True Random Number Generator (TRNG)
Applications:
- Object Detection and Classification
- Audio Processing: Multi-Keyword Recognition, Sound Classification, Noise Cancellation
- Facial Recognition
- Time-Series Data Processing: Heart Rate/Health Signal Analysis, Multi-Sensor Analysis, Predictive Maintenance
Package:
- 81-pin CTBGA (8mm x 8mm, 0.8mm pitch)
Features
- Dual Core Ultra-Low-Power Microcontroller
- Arm Cortex-M4 Processor with FPU up to 100MHz
- 512KB Flash and 128KB SRAM
- Optimized Performance with 16KB Instruction Cache
- Optional Error Correction Code (ECC-SEC-DED) for SRAM
- 32-Bit RISC-V Coprocessor up to 60MHz
- Up to 52 General-Purpose I/O Pins
- 12-Bit Parallel Camera Interface
- One I 2 S Master/Slave for Digital Audio Interface
- Neural Network Accelerator
- Highly Optimized for Deep Convolutional Neural Networks
- 442k 8-Bit Weight Capacity with 1,2,4,8-Bit Weights
- Programmable Input Image Size up to 1024 x 1024 pixels
- Programmable Network Depth up to 64 Layers
- Programmable per Layer Network Channel Widths up to 1024 Channels
- 1 and 2 Dimensional Convolution Processing
- Streaming Mode
- Flexibility to Support Other Network Types, Including MLP and Recurrent Neural Networks
- Power Management Maximizes Operating Time for Battery Applications
- Integrated Single-Inductor Multiple-Output (SIMO) Switch-Mode Power Supply (SMPS)
- 2.0V to 3.6V SIMO Supply Voltage Range
- Dynamic Voltage Scaling Minimizes Active Core Power Consumption
- 22.2μA/MHz While Loop Execution at 3.0V from Cache (CM4 Only)
- Selectable SRAM Retention in Low-Power Modes with Real-Time Clock (RTC) Enabled
- Security and Integrity
- Available Secure Boot
- AES 128/192/256 Hardware Acceleration Engine
- True Random Number Generator (TRNG) Seed Generator
Ordering Information appears at end of data sheet.
Arm and Cortex are registered trademarks of Arm Limited (or its subsidiaries) in the US and/or elsewhere.
CoreMark is a registered trademark of the Embedded Microprocessor Benchmark Consortium.
Motorola is a registered trademark of Motorola Trademark Holdings, LLC.
PyTorch is a trademark of Facebook, Inc.
TensorFlow is a trademark of Google, Inc.
Applications
- Object Detection and Classification
- Audio Processing: Multi-Keyword Recognition, Sound Classification, Noise Cancellation
- Facial Recognition
- Time-Series Data Processing: Heart Rate/Health Signal Analysis, Multi-Sensor Analysis, Predictive Maintenance
Pin Configuration
Electrical Characteristics
(Limits are 100% tested at T A = +25°C and T A = +105°C. TYP specifications are provided for T A = +25°C. Limits over the operating temperature range and relevant supply voltage range are guaranteed by design and characterization. Specifications marked GBD are guaranteed by design and not production tested. Specifications to the minimum operating temperature are guaranteed by design and are not production tested. GPIO are only tested at T A = +105°C.)
| PARAMETER | SYMBOL | CONDITIONS | MIN | TYP | MAX | UNITS |
|---|---|---|---|---|---|---|
| POWER SUPPLIES | POWER SUPPLIES | POWER SUPPLIES | POWER SUPPLIES | POWER SUPPLIES | POWER SUPPLIES | POWER SUPPLIES |
| Core Input Supply Voltage A | V COREA | Falling | V COREA V RST | 1.1 | 1.21 | V |
| V COREA | Rising | 0.9 | 1.1 | 1.21 | V | |
| Core Input Supply Voltage B | V COREB | Falling | V COREB V RST | 1.1 | 1.21 | V |
| Core Input Supply Voltage B | V COREB | Rising | 0.9 | 1.1 | 1.21 | V |
Absolute Maximum Ratings
| Parameter | Limit |
|---|---|
| V COREA , V COREB | -0.3V to +1.21V |
| V DDIO | -0.3V to +3.6V |
| V DDIOH | -0.3V to +3.6V |
| V REGI | -0.3V to +3.6V |
| V DDA | -0.3V to +1.89V |
| GPIO (V DDIO ) | -0.3V to V DDIO + 0.5V |
| RSTN, GPIO (V DDIOH ) | -0.3V to V DDIOH + 0.5V |
| 32KIN, 32KOUT | -0.3V to V DDA + 0.2V |
| V DDIO Combined Pins (sink) | 100mA |
| V DDIOH Combined Pins (sink) | 100mA |
| V | 100mA |
| Parameter | Limit |
|---|---|
| V SS | 200mA |
| V SSPWR | 100mA |
| Output Current (sink) by any GPIO Pin | 25mA |
| Output Current (source) by any GPIO Pin | -25mA |
| Continuous Package Power Dissipation CTBGA (multilayer | |
| board) T A = +70°C (derate 29.81mW/°C above +70°C) | 2384.50mW |
| Operating Temperature Range | -40°C to +105°C |
| Storage Temperature Range | -65°C to +150°C |
| Soldering Temperature | +260°C |
Stresses beyond those listed under 'Absolute Maximum Ratings' may cause permanent damage to the device. These are stress ratings only, and functional operation of the device at these or any other conditions beyond those indicated in the operational sections of the specifications is not implied. Exposure to absolute maximum rating conditions for extended periods may affect device reliability.
Ordering Information
| PART | FLASH (KB) | SYSTEM RAM (KB) | BOOTLOADER | SECURE BOOTLOADER | PIN-PACKAGE |
|---|---|---|---|---|---|
| MAX78000EXG+ | 512 | 128 + ECC 8 | Yes | No | 81 CTBGA |
Related Variants
The following components are covered by the same datasheet.
| Part Number | Manufacturer | Package |
|---|---|---|
| MAX78000EXG | Maxim Integrated | — |
| MAX78000EXG+ | Analog Devices Inc./Maxim Integrated | 81-LFBGA |
Get structured datasheet data via API
Get started free